From this point forward, Kerr Dam on the Flathead River has a new name: Salish-Kootenai Dam. “We decided to name it after the new owners,” said Confederated Salish and Kootenai Tribes chairman Vernon Finley. On Saturday, CSKT held a celebration at the Joe McDonald Health and Fitness Center of Salish Kootenai College in Pablo to commemorate the tribes’ official takeover as owners of the dam, after paying nearly $18.3 million to NorthWestern Energy to acquire the facility.
